Rough Trade Recommends: The 113 + Fiona-Lee + House Of Women
Rough Trade East, E1 6QL , [Venue Details]Rough Trade Recommends presents: The 113, Fiona-Lee and House of Women
Rough Trade's monthly new music showcase returns with some of the best up-and-coming acts in the alternative scene.
THE 113 (UK)
Pulverising and angular post punk perfection.
Crawling out of the cracks of Leeds' inner city, The 113 conveys a realistic and bleak outlook on everyday life, combining the style of Post Punk, Dance Punk and Noise Rock.
Fiona-Lee
Tackling themes of vulnerability, shame and grief in her music, Yorkshire native Fiona-Lee channels formidable vocals, remarkable storytelling and crunching sensibilities into guitar-driven anthems that are already resonating with audiences far and wide.
House Of Women
House of Women are shaping up to be the UK’s next rising alt-rock hope, their fiery psychedelia-tinged grunge making them a hot tip after the release of debut EP ‘People Printing’. Their full-intensity live shows first ignited their reputation with incendiary performances at All Points East and 2000trees, and they’ve since gone on to sell out venues across England, cementing their place as one of the most exciting new live acts.
